Understanding the Basics
A driving license is an official file that certifies a person's ability to operate an automobile. It is provided by a government firm and is needed to legally drive in a lot of nations. The procedure of acquiring a driving license can differ depending on the jurisdiction, but it generally includes numerous essential actions.
Actions to Obtain a Driving License
Identify Eligibility
Age Requirements: Most countries have a minimum age requirement for acquiring a chauffeur's license. In the United States, for instance, the minimum age is usually 16 years of ages, but this can differ by state.Residency: You must be a legal homeowner of the state or nation where you are getting a license.Medical Fitness: You need to meet specific health and vision requirements to ensure you can securely operate a car.
Study the Driving Manual
Driving Manual: Each state or country supplies a driving manual that covers traffic laws, roadway signs, and safe driving practices. It is important to completely study this manual to get ready for the composed test.Online Resources: Many jurisdictions provide online resources, such as practice tests and interactive tutorials, to help you prepare.
Take the Written Test
Test Format: The composed test normally consists of multiple-choice questions that evaluate your knowledge of traffic laws and safe driving practices.Passing Score: The passing score varies by jurisdiction, but it is usually around 80%.Retakes: If you do not pass the test on your first attempt, you can usually retake it after a specific period.
Total Driver's Education (if needed)
Driver's Education: Some states or countries need new drivers to finish a driver's education course. This can be carried out in a class setting or online.Behind-the-Wheel Training: In addition to class direction, you may need to complete a particular variety of hours of behind-the-wheel training with a qualified trainer.
Make an application for a Learner's Permit
Application Process: You can obtain a student's authorization at your local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) or equivalent agency.Documents Required: You will require to offer evidence of identity, residency, and age. Appropriate documents normally consist of a birth certificate, passport, and utility bill.Charges: There is typically a cost for the learner's authorization, which can differ by jurisdiction.
Practice Driving
Supervised Driving: With a student's authorization, you can practice driving under the supervision of a licensed grownup. This is a crucial step to gain confidence and experience.Practice Tips: Start in low-traffic locations and slowly work your method as much as more challenging driving conditions. Practice different driving circumstances, such as merging, parking, and browsing intersections.
Take the Driving Test
Test Format: The driving test evaluates your capability to safely run an automobile. You will be assessed on your driving abilities, adherence to traffic laws, and total safety.Test Day: On the day of your test, get here early, bring your student's authorization, and guarantee your lorry is in good condition.Passing Criteria: The passing criteria can vary, but normally, you need to show safe and proficient driving skills.
Receive Your Driver's License
License Types: Depending on your age and experience, you might get a provisionary or full motorist's license. Provisional licenses typically feature constraints, such as a curfew or traveler limitations.License Renewal: Your license will have an expiration date. Q: Can I drive with a student's license?A: Yes, however you must be accompanied by a certified adult who is at least 21 years of ages (the age requirement may vary by jurisdiction). You are also based on certain limitations, such as a curfew or guest limits.

Q: What happens if I fail the driving test?A: If you stop working the driving test, you can typically retake it after a certain period. The waiting duration and variety of retakes allowed can differ by jurisdiction. Use the time to practice and enhance your driving abilities.

Q: Can I transfer my motorist's license to a brand-new state?A: Yes, the majority of states permit you to transfer your chauffeur's license if you move. You will need to check out the local DMV and supply proof of your brand-new address. You might also need to take a vision test or a written test, depending upon the state.

Q: Are there any age limitations for driving?A: Yes, the majority of nations have age limitations for acquiring a driver's license. In the United States, the minimum age is typically 16 years of ages, but this can differ by state. Some states also have restrictions for chauffeurs under 18, such as a curfew or passenger limitations.
